Join a fully funded 3.5-year PhD program at the University of Manchester, focusing on developing advanced thin-film composite mixed-matrix membranes for productive gas separation applications.
Experience practical insights through SLB. This academic project, in collaboration with SLB, aims to create data-driven solutions for membrane technology facing industrial challenges in carbon capture. Candidates must have a strong academic background in relevant sciences or engineering fields, alongside programming capabilities in differential equations. Key Responsibilities:
- Develop a digital twin model for membrane performance
- Validate designs with empirical data from experiments
- Investigate structural changes under high-pressure conditions
- Assess degradation and permeability dynamics
- Engage in an internship with SLB for data access Requirements:
- Relevant honours degree minimum of 2.1 or master’s
- Strong programming skills for mathematical modeling
- Knowledge in chemical or mechanical engineering disciplines
- Experience with computational models in research
- Enthusiasm for industry-aligned academic research Advance your academic career in membrane technology and contribute to sustainable gas separation advancements at the University of Manchester.
